I don't like the WA, mostly because its function is to legislate the world and I dislike legislation. Also too much stuff is proposed and passed. Its whole structure is also fundamentally broken, as a majority can essentially oppress a minority. What's that, 40% of the vote was against? Oh well, screw that 40% of the WORLD.
In addition, it works on a massively influential snowball vote. Intelligent voters aside, the large majority of voters base their vote off of whatever vote is most popular. As such, if a bunch of people vote in favor of a proposal as soon as it enters referendum, then that would likely result in that proposal having a majority in favor over time.
Then, there’s also the problem of botting and puppeting. I’m sure that there are some people who bot tons of puppets into the WA with separate emails.
It’s just a vulnerable system overall and I don’t believe that it serves its purpose well.
That would probably work in eliminating that problem, but it could come with mixed results. One key thing to consider is that most of the time, the majority is right, so letting voters see what the current vote is can give them a sense of direction. The problem comes when they take that majority as an answer to every proposal and don’t use it correctly - as a base opinion to consider while reading the full proposal or looking at discussion threads.
It’s really just an overall lack of education in voters that makes the WA such a stupid system. The simplest way to solve that would be by having only some nations vote, in the form of a sort of council. However, that’s never really gonna happen.
